首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试为每个Axois POST请求发送一个错误对象,但在服务器上获取一个空对象

对于这个问题,你可以使用Axios库来发送POST请求,并在请求中附带一个错误对象。但是,在服务器端接收到请求时获取到的对象为空。

首先,Axios是一个常用的HTTP客户端库,用于在浏览器和Node.js中发送HTTP请求。它支持各种HTTP请求方法,包括GET、POST等。Axios提供了丰富的功能,如设置请求头、处理响应、拦截请求等。

针对这个问题,你可以按照以下步骤来实现:

  1. 引入Axios库:
  2. 引入Axios库:
  3. 创建一个错误对象:
  4. 创建一个错误对象:
  5. 发送POST请求并附带错误对象:
  6. 发送POST请求并附带错误对象:

在上述代码中,/api/endpoint是你想要发送POST请求的目标URL。errorObject是你创建的错误对象,包含了messagecode属性。你可以根据需要修改这个对象的属性。

在服务器端接收到请求时,你可以按照相应的方式来获取请求体中的对象。具体的操作取决于你使用的后端技术栈和框架。以下是一个使用Node.js和Express框架的示例:

代码语言:txt
复制
const express = require('express');
const app = express();

app.use(express.json()); // 解析请求体中的JSON数据

app.post('/api/endpoint', (req, res) => {
  const data = req.body; // 获取请求体中的对象
  console.log(data);
  res.send(data); // 返回相同的对象作为响应
});

app.listen(3000, () => {
  console.log('Server is running on port 3000');
});

上述代码中,express.json()中间件用于解析请求体中的JSON数据,并将其转换为JavaScript对象。在POST请求的处理函数中,我们可以通过req.body获取到请求体中的对象,并将其打印出来。

需要注意的是,以上代码只是示例,具体的实现可能会因应用程序和开发环境而异。你需要根据你的具体情况来进行调整和优化。

推荐的腾讯云相关产品:云服务器(ECS),产品介绍链接地址:https://cloud.tencent.com/product/cvm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券